Features:
| • | Keeps exercise ball stable for various ball exercises | | • | Can be used as a base for using an exercise ball as a chair | | • | Holes in base allow for exercise tubing (sold separately) to be attached for additional exercise possibilities | | • | Dimensions: 19"W x 2"H | | • | Available in Black |

Editorial Reviews:
Product Description The Isokinetics Ball Base is designed to hold a therapy ball in place while a user works to improve balance reactions. Stabilizing the ball surface lets users receive the benefits of a therapy ball while controlling the ball movement.

Even better alternative for a Balance Ball Chair August 12, 2008 2 out of 2 found this review helpful
Originally I was interested in purchasing a Balance Ball Chair, but at $70 and just starting out I decided to go with the Balance Ball Base, the less expensive way to go.
Not only does the base keep the ball from rolling while at your desk this unit will connect with an exercise strap for working out.
So for approximately $20 (Base and Shipping-shpg about same cost as the base) it's pretty worth it and very satisfied with it and perhaps even a better alternative to a Balance Ball Chair.
